POSITION
TITLE: |
Director, Nursing (Pending Budgetary Approval) |
REPORTS TO: |
Chair, Health Sciences |
BASIC FUNCTION: |
Organizes, administers, reviews, and assures effectiveness of all nursing programs
Coordinates strategic planning and participates in budget planning for nursing programs
Coordinates program efforts in achieving and maintaining NLN accreditation
Develops and implements an assessment plan that identifies benchmarks for the measurement of outcomes in relation to the mission statement and goals, and uses results for program improvement.
Encourages curricular and academic practices which promote the synthesis of theory, use of current technology, competent clinical practice, and professional values.
Provides academic, behavioral, and clinical advisement to enrolled and prospective students
Safeguards the health and safety of students through the implementation of published policies and procedures that are in compliance with Florida Board of Nursing regulations and the National League of Nursing, as well as those with regard to workplace hazards, harassment, communicable diseases, and substance abuse.
Demonstrates integrity in representations to communities of interest and the public, in pursuit of educational excellence, and in treatment of and respect for students, faculty, and staff. |

| RESPONSIBILITIES: |
- Coordinates all BSN, RN and LPN program matters, including but not limited to curriculum development and review, student advisement and registration, transcript evaluation and graduation procedures.
- Pursues innovative means to assure continued success of all nursing programs, including program development and evaluation, curriculum innovation and resource management.
- Provides leadership for BSN, RN and LPN faculty. Orients new adjunct and full-time nursing faculty. Prepares faculty instructional assignments each term according to criteria in Manual of Policy.
- Prepares class schedules each term; maintains master plan for clinical schedule with other agencies.
- Maintain formal communications with clinical agencies, community groups and other nursing programs. Prepares and distributes master clinical schedule each term, and coordinates clinical agency staff / faculty planning meetings.
- Prepares departmental budget annually. Monitors budgets and makes adjustments as needed. Reviews and submits request for books, audio-visual, CAI purchases and equipment purchases, and monitors campus lab supply orders and annual nursing department equipment inventory.
- Serves as a member of nursing program Admissions Committee. Reviews files, prepares materials for transfer applicants and re-admission applicants to present to nursing admissions committee. Serves as advisory member for background screening appeal hearings.
- Schedules and coordinates (with chair of committee) nursing Advisory Committee meetings. Corresponds and communicates with committee members as needed regarding committee activities, makes recommendations to the President annually regarding advisory committee membership.
- Coordinates review and revision of all nursing program handbooks and catalog changes annually.
- Prepares annual report for Florida State Board of Nursing, Southern Regional Education Board and National League for Nursing. Maintains all student documentation associated with accreditation requirements.
- Assists with recruitment activities.
- Prepares or assists in preparation of grant proposals for department.
- Coordinates planning / implementation of the annual pinning ceremony for nursing graduates.
- Maintains assigned instructional load.
- Advises and delegates tasks for coordinators and assistant coordinators.
- Other duties as assigned.
- Interviews and makes recommendations to Health Sciences Division chair regarding prospective faculty.
- Conducts full-time and adjunct faculty evaluations.
- Provides leadership and mentoring activities to faculty and students.
- Reviews clinical agency contracts annually.
- Conducts on-going program assessment, and evaluates and assures effectiveness of clinical education.
- Assumes leadership role in the continued development of the program.

MINIMUM
QUALIFICATIONS: |
Doctorate in Nursing (DNS, DNP or Ph.D.). Proficiency in curriculum design and program administration. Documented equivalent of three years full-time experience in the discipline, and a current FL RN license (
Active Registered Nursing License from the Florida Board of Nursing, BCLS, and Health Certifications required for Florida Licensure (HIPAA, Domestic Violence, HIV-AIDS, Medical Errors & Infection Control)). Two years each of nursing education and managment experience preferred. |
